  • Abstract
    The scrapping of plans to build the £30bn Severn Estuary barrage in October last year were a problem for the UK. The decision followed decades of debate on the impact on biodiversity and wildlife, flood management, local geology and water quality. Such environmental issues, coupled with a dwindling number of suitable sites, are duplicated across Europe. The result is a revival in interest in small-scale hydroelectric schemes.
